The U.S. Department of Veteran Affairs (VA) is seeking information and sources capable of providing the services described below. The purpose of this notice is to gather capabilities and market information pertinent for acquisition planning. The responses to this Sources Sought will contribute to determining the method of procurement and identify parties having an interest in and the resources to support this requirement. THERE IS NO SOLICITATION AT THIS TIME This Sources Sought does not constitute a request for quotes or proposals. Submission of any information in response to this Sources Sought is purely voluntary. The Government assumes no financial responsibility for any costs incurred.

DESCRIPTION OF REQUIREMENT: VA is seeking a Contractor to provide comm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) Kirkpatrick evaluation training in either face-to-face or virtual sessions.

The Human Capital Services Center (HCSC) is an organization within the Office of Human Resources and Administration/Operations, Security, and Preparedness (HRA/OSP) that supports the strategic goals of the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) by providing an enterprise-wide approach to talent management, including recruitment, retention, development, training.

HCSC has a need to provide Kirkpatrick training for Department learning and development program managers to learn the correct methodology and apply it to an actual VA leadership and development programs to maximize program effectiveness.

The following Kirkpatrick evaluation training is required: Course Modality Certification Kirkpatrick Four Levels® Evaluation Training Program Bronze Level In-Person Kirkpatrick Certified Professional Bronze Level credential Kirkpatrick Four Levels® Evaluation Training Program Bronze Level Virtual Kirkpatrick Certified Professional Bronze Level credential Kirkpatrick Four Levels® Evaluation Training Program Silver Level In-Person Kirkpatrick Certified Professional Silver Level credential Kirkpatrick Four Levels® Evaluation Training Program Silver Level Virtual Kirkpatrick Certified Professional Silver Level credential Workshop Modality Certification Igniting the Inner Fire: Kirkpatrick Levels 3 & 4 In-Person Course completion Igniting the Inner Fire: Kirkpatrick Levels 3 & 4 Virtual Course completion Training on Trial Workshop In-Person Course completion Training on Trial Workshop Virtual Course completion All instructors must have a Certification as a Kirkpatrick Facilitator or Kirkpatrick Consultant. The company must be able to issue the Bronze Level and Silver Level Credentials (to include digital certificate and badge) to all participants.
